Bengkulu city has potential in marine and fisheries sector which has not been managed with maximum. The purpose of this research is to see how the prospects for the development of fishery business in Bengkulu city taking into account the revenue and feasibility of capture fisheries of small fishing boats and paying trawlers boats. This research conducted in Pulau Baai and Pasar Baru. Respondents were selected using census method as many as 24 small fishing boats and 10 payang trawlers boats. Methods analysis using business analytics and business efficiency. This results showed that the fishery business in Bengkulu city has an efficient and feasible to be developed with R/C ratio 2,37 and B/C ratio 1,37 for small fishing boats. For paying trawlers boats obtained R/C ratio 1,52 and B/C ratio 0,52.Published
